## Reviewer checklist (per chapter)
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
Run after each chapter's generation completes and before scaling:
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
1. **Duplicate entities.** `artifacts/entities/` and the report's
|
|||
|
|
`## Entities` list. Look for near-duplicates (e.g. `Larry
|
|||
|
|
Livingston` vs `The narrator`, or `Bucket Shop` vs
|
|||
|
|
`Cosmopolitan Stock Brokerage Company` when the latter is intended
|
|||
|
|
as a specific instance). Merge or split before continuing.
|
|||
|
|
2. **Relation endpoints.** Every relation's `## Subject` and
|
|||
|
|
`## Object` should match an existing entity title. Anything that
|
|||
|
|
does not should either gain an entity or be dropped.
|
|||
|
|
3. **Weak evidence.** Open the `## Evidence` section of each relation
|
|||
|
|
and confirm it quotes a concrete phrase from the source chunk, not
|
|||
|
|
a paraphrase. Relations with evidence like "the chapter implies…"
|
|||
|
|
should be downgraded or removed.
|
|||
|
|
4. **Overgeneralization.** For every entity whose category is
|
|||
|
|
`strategy`, `error`, `psychological_pattern`, or
|
|||
|
|
`evidence_bearing_claim`, check the evaluation's
|
|||
|
|
`overgeneralization_risk` score and read the `## Review Notes` it
|
|||
|
|
produced. Anything that silently universalises a chapter-local
|
|||
|
|
claim ("traders always…", "every market does…") should be
|
|||
|
|
re-scoped or dropped.
|
|||
|
|
5. **Page anchor coverage.** The report's `## Page anchors` section
|
|||
|
|
should show anchors actually present in the source. If the anchor
|
|||
|
|
count is zero for a chapter that should have them, intake mis-fired.
|
|||
|
|
6. **Unmapped source chunks.** The report's `## Unmapped source
|
|||
|
|
chunks` section must be empty before a full-book run. Any chunk
|
|||
|
|
listed there had its entity or relation stage skip silently — fix
|
|||
|
|
the underlying workflow or re-run with a different selection.
|
|||
|
|
7. **Plan-vs-actual variance.** `output/budget/summary.yaml` and the
|
|||
|
|
"Plan variance" line of the report. If actual is more than 1.5×
|
|||
|
|
estimated for either calls or tokens, re-plan before scaling.

## Scale-up plan
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
To go from a reviewed one-chapter run to the full Lefevre book:
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
1. Re-plan against the full book: `infospace-bench generate plan
|
|||
|
|
<root> --cost-per-1k <rate>` and inspect
|
|||
|
|
`total_provider_calls_estimate`, `total_prompt_tokens_estimate`,
|
|||
|
|
and `estimated_cost_usd`. The current real-book numbers are 730
|
|||
|
|
calls / ~518k tokens / ~$155 at $0.30/1k.
|
|||
|
|
2. Pick a defensible cost-cap. If the plan shows estimated cost above
|
|||
|
|
the cap, narrow selection with `--from-chapter`/`--to-chapter`
|
|||
|
|
before running.
|
|||
|
|
3. Pick the final model. Confirm an entry exists in
|
|||
|
|
`src/infospace_bench/model_rates.yaml` (or a workspace override) so
|
|||
|
|
`cost_usd_estimated` lines up with reality. List prices drift —
|
|||
|
|
refresh `captured_at` if older than 90 days.
|
|||
|
|
4. Run one chapter, review per the checklist above, then either
|
|||
|
|
continue chapter-by-chapter or batch via
|
|||
|
|
`--from-chapter`/`--to-chapter`. Resume is whole-run-skip today
|
|||
|
|
(see Risks); avoid relying on it for partial recovery.
|
|||
|
|
5. After each successful range, archive the infospace with
|
|||
|
|
`infospace-bench archive` so the budget log, the metrics, and the
|
|||
|
|
generated artifacts all land in a single content-addressed package.

## Risks still load-bearing
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
These do not block a one-chapter run but should be re-checked before a
|
|||
|
|
full-book run:
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
- **Cross-chunk entity dedupe.** Exact-title upsert works (same entity
|
|||
|
|
title across chunks collapses to one file), but near-duplicate dedup
|
|||
|
|
is still a reviewer responsibility. Plan: only proceed to multi-
|
|||
|
|
chapter once a chapter's entity list has been hand-pruned.
|
|||
|
|
- **Whole-run resume.** `generate resume` skips a completed run; it
|
|||
|
|
does not skip just-completed-chunks. For a real 24-chapter run that
|
|||
|
|
fails midway, the safest recovery today is a new infospace with the
|
|||
|
|
remaining chapter range — not resume on the original.
|
|||
|
|
- **Adaptive routing.** The current single-model run is fine for one
|
|||
|
|
chapter but expensive at full-book scale. The cost-quality routing
|
|||
|
|
layer is parked in `llm-connect` `LLM-WP-0004`; the consumer wiring
|
|||
|
|
is parked in `infospace-bench` `IB-WP-0018`. Either land that work
|
|||
|
|
first or accept the single-model bill.
|
|||
|
|
- **Provider rate drift.** The default rate table in
|
|||
|
|
`src/infospace_bench/model_rates.yaml` captured prices on 2026-05-17.
|
|||
|
|
Refresh before a full-book run if the file is older than 90 days.
